Retirement planning is the process of preparing financially for life after leaving the workforce. It involves setting financial goals, saving and investing money, and creating strategies to generate income during retirement.
Retirement planning helps individuals build the resources needed to support their lifestyle once regular employment income stops.
Without proper planning, individuals may face financial hardship during retirement. Retirement planning helps ensure that savings, investments, and benefits are sufficient to cover living expenses over potentially decades.
Early planning also allows individuals to take advantage of compounding investment growth.
